Atmaspheric Endeavors on the N90
Atmaspheric Endeavors has posted an early, well thought out and positve review about the N90. They also cite one of the recurring issues, the lack of Apple to make their iSync tools more friendly.
I experienced the same thing with my Pocket PC phones in the past and have yet, even after trying two different Sync programs. One would think that someone would figure there is a huge market for Syncing with Macs and really get it right, simply and elegantly.
I'm hoping that the N90 Bloggers support team comes up with some work arounds. It's been reported to me that there are some Nokia folks who also use the Mac so we're waiting to get some "unofficial, non-supported" solutions very soon.

MacOSXhints.com posts a solution for setting up iSync to N90 synchronisation here. I tried the solution on my PowerBook with Tiger (OS X 10.4.3) and it works perfect. The only problem I've encountered so far is, that Contacts with an URL (Entry Homepage) are not synchronized.
